Woodbridge A. Foster is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Plant Science and Insect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Woodbridge A. Foster has authored 79 papers receiving a total of 2.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 40 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 35 papers in Plant Science and 32 papers in Insect Science. Recurrent topics in Woodbridge A. Foster’s work include Mosquito-borne diseases and control (35 papers), Insect Pest Control Strategies (33 papers) and Malaria Research and Control (25 papers). Woodbridge A. Foster is often cited by papers focused on Mosquito-borne diseases and control (35 papers), Insect Pest Control Strategies (33 papers) and Malaria Research and Control (25 papers). Woodbridge A. Foster collaborates with scholars based in United States, Ethiopia and Kenya. Woodbridge A. Foster's co-authors include Richard E. Gary, Chris Stone, Willem Takken, Wee L. Yee, Robin M. Taylor, Ahmed Hassanali, John C. Beier, Bryan T. Jackson, Arden O. Lea and Robert R. Jackson and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Science and PLoS ONE.
